Boise City Rotarians Attend District Conference

On Friday, October 31, four members of the Boise City Rotary Club, a Rotary Exchange Student and six member of a visiting Group Study Exchange Team from Great Britain traveled to Wichita, Kansas to attend the Rotary District 5690 Conference. The club members, Ron Kincannon, Terri Weaver, Mike and Helen Barnes are all district officers and Barbara Weaver is a Rotary Exchange Student, who recently returned from Australia.

The district conference is an annual event held in each of the 532 districts of Rotary International worldwide. District 5690 includes 30 clubs in south Kansas and the Oklahoma panhandle. The conference is held in a different city of the district each year.

During the four days of the conference the Rotarians enjoyed presentations by wonderful speakers from across the country and around the world. Presenters included Jerry Traylor, the cerebral palsy victim who climbed Pikes Peak and completed a 3,528 mile run across the United States on crutches, Rotary International Director Nominee Ken Grabeau from Nashua, New Hampshire, who provides home water purification systems in remote rural areas of South America, and New York Fire Department battalion commander Richard Picciotto, the last surviving fireman out of the collapsed World Trade Center Towers, and Leah Klass, a Rotary World Peace Fellow that completed her education as a Rotary Peace Scholar at the University of Queensland in Brisbane, Australia and now provides conflict resolution around the world. They were inspired by presentations by the Group Study Exchange team from England and a returning team from Argentina, and presentations by four Rotary Exchange Students from India, France and Australia, as well as Rotary International President’s Representative George Atwell from Milford, Virginia, and several other interesting and motivating speakers.

The group was also treated to world-class entertainment by country star and comedian Jimmy Travis and western artist album of the year winners, The Diamond W Wranglers. The attendees enjoyed fellowship of old and new friends in Rotary and were hosted by the 391 member club of Downtown Wichita at the historic Broadview Hotel.

The Boise City Rotarians returned home, tired but excited, with renewed inspiration from the event. The Boise City Club will host the District Conference next August in Oklahoma City at the Clarion Convention Center at I-40 and Meridian and are looking forward to another exciting year of Rotary service.
